About This Item

Edinburgh: THE SCOTTISH MOUNTAINEERING TRUST, 1968. 4th Edition . Hardcover. Near Fine/Very Good Plus. A MAJOR REVISION BY DR ADAM WATSON AND OTHERSE. 4TH edition, 1968. VERY GOOD PLUS wrapper with slight nicks on fine book, not price clipped. Light rubbing to wrapper.With 32 illustrations and map in 5 colours.
